WebA Life of Change. As we go from infants to toddlers, sleep becomes more consolidated and naps less frequent. Over a typical lifespan, the amount of time we spend each day sleeping declines. Newborns spend from 16 to 20 hours asleep each day. Between the ages of one and four, total daily sleep time decreases to about 11 or 12 hours.
